Output 8de766b0d498fc1dc682149d7ad28a7a07527be9c844ca5320bffafdd3499120:5

value
307663000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c7d90b7975680d30259b20c7cff1de1f63392ffd OP_EQUAL
address
MS7ri9FVypmrcy2TcziE6oQyZMb9kvJtQD
transaction
8de766b0d498fc1dc682149d7ad28a7a07527be9c844ca5320bffafdd3499120
spent
true